public class AAIServiceSubscription {
private String serviceType;
+
+ private String resourceVersion;
@JsonCreator
- public AAIServiceSubscription(@JsonProperty("service-type") String serviceType) {
+ public AAIServiceSubscription(@JsonProperty("service-type") String serviceType,@JsonProperty("resource-version") String resourceVersion) {
this.serviceType = serviceType;
+ this.resourceVersion = resourceVersion;
}
@JsonProperty("service-type")
public String getServiceType() {
return serviceType;
}
+
+ @JsonProperty("resource-version")
+ public String getResourceVersion() {
+ return resourceVersion;
+ }
}
@Test
public void itCanRetrieveServiceSubscriptionsFromAAI() {
- List<AAIServiceSubscription> serviceSubscriptions = singletonList(new AAIServiceSubscription("service type"));
+ List<AAIServiceSubscription> serviceSubscriptions = singletonList(new AAIServiceSubscription("service type","resourceVersion"));
AAIService aaiService = mock(AAIService.class);
ServiceSubscriptionRsp rsp = new ServiceSubscriptionRsp();